    The Guide to Protecting Your Mental Well-Being When Dating





    Are you ready to start dating? The dating world can be a fun and exciting experience, but you should always prioritize your mental wellbeing. Setting boundaries and practicing self-care are just a few ways to keep a healthy mind while dating. This guide offers tips and advice for how to prioritize your mental wellbeing while dating.





    Dating can provide a lot of excitement. Dating, meeting new people and perhaps finding love, can be an exciting experience. This can be an exciting time, but it can also bring stress, anxiety, or even heartache. While dating, you should prioritize your mental wellbeing and health. Here are some tips for protecting your mental health while dating.

    Setting Boundaries

    In order to maintain your mental well-being, it is vital that you set boundaries. You should communicate to your partner your limits and needs, and be clear on what you're comfortable with. You can set boundaries for communication, physical intimacy, or the pace of your relationship. Setting boundaries will help you to ensure your needs are met, and you won't compromise your mental health in order to be with someone.

    You Should Take Time For Yourself





    While dating it is important to make time for you. Spending time alone will help you recharge your batteries and improve your overall well-being. You can do this by engaging in hobbies, exercising, or practicing self-care. Taking some time for you can help you to gain a fresh perspective on your dating experience and ensure you're not neglecting yourself when it comes to pursuing a relationship.





    Seeking Support





    It is essential to have a solid support network in place. Dating can bring up a lot of emotions, so it's best to be prepared. Having someone to discuss your dating experiences, be it a family member, friend or therapist, can be invaluable. Support systems can give you perspective, empathy and validation. They can also help you navigate dating challenges with a sense stability and support.





    Managing Expectations





    It's easy to get caught up in the excitement of dating and to have high expectations for a relationship. You should manage your expectations, and be realistic when it comes to dating. You shouldn't expect every date to lead to a lasting relationship. You can protect your mental wellbeing by managing your expectations and avoiding disappointment.





    Recognizing Red Flags





    When dating, be alert to red flags. They may indicate that you are at risk of harming your mental well-being. This can include manipulative behaviors, gaslighting and disrespect. If you recognize these red-flags early on, it will help protect your mental wellbeing from a relationship with negative effects. Never be afraid of following your instincts or leaving a relationship that does not feel right.





    Practicing Self-Compassion





    Dating can be a time of rejection, disappointment and insecurities. Self-compassion is key to the dating process. Reminding yourself that rejections are not an indication of your worth is important. Also, it's OK to feel vulnerable or uncertain. You can maintain your resilience and protect your mental wellbeing by practicing self-compassion.
